Transaction 18600f120ea9c20f288d4de5845625b56e0e41abb417f4a1ee7d4ee971360b44
1 Input
1 Output
-
18600f120ea9c20f288d4de5845625b56e0e41abb417f4a1ee7d4ee971360b44:0
- value
- 84693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 558d310987e64f6c742d66d88ecb027d465924e3 OP_EQUAL
- address
- 39VNW1Z1utq5tm8Do1cowZde3TqEvJzcBf